It's time to pay tribute to volunteers:
Local energiser will win a prize of DKK 75,000

These days, candidates from all over Denmark are being nominated for the Energiser of the Year award; an honour which is accompanied by a prize of DKK 75,000. Nominated candidates from Zealand currently outnumber the rest of Denmark, but this may still change. The deadline is 19 November.

Every day, volunteers in local sports associations and sports clubs make an effort to inflate balls, coach teams, arrange tournaments and organise transportation for matches.

Together with the Sports Confederation of Denmark we wish to pay tribute to the volunteers who perform this hugely important work – which local association activities are so dependent on – in local sports associations all over Denmark. And just now, volunteers from all over Denmark are being nominated for the Energiser of the Year award.

"With this award, we want to emphasise the great efforts made by thousands of volunteers in Danish sports clubs and associations. An unselfish effort of crucial importance to local association activities," says Hanne Blume, our Chief HR Officer, who is part of the panel deciding who'll receive the award.
 

Deadline on 19 November

A lot of volunteers have been nominated since the registration opened on 6 November. It's not too late to nominate a volunteer. The nomination period for the Energiser of the Year award runs until 19 November 2017, and nominating takes place at orsted.com/energibundt (only in Danish).

The Energiser of the Year award will be presented at the large sports show 'Sport 2017' held by the Danish national TV channel 'DR' on 6 January 2018 in Boxen in Herning. The winner of the award can look forward to a prize of DKK 75,000, and the first and second runner-ups will each receive DKK 10,000.
